    The Farm at Prophetstown

    The Farm at Prophetstown

    For your first stop on the way home, pop into the Farm at Prophetstown to experience what farm life was like in the 1920s. The farm is fun for the whole family, offering the chance to interact with all the free range animals, tour the barn, visit a blacksmith shop, and walk through two farmhouses that act as museums offering a glimpse into family life during the time period. You can pick up some local farm-made goods including fresh vegetables and eggs while stopping.     Paradise Spring Historical Park

    Paradise Spring Historical Park

    Take a relaxing stroll and break for lunch at Paradise Spring Historical Park located on the Wabash River. The park offers paved trails to walk on and historical cabins to admire along the trails. The cabins serve as relics of a bygone era — the park once served as a meeting place for treaty negotiations with Native peoples.

    Johnny Appleseed Grave

    Johnny Appleseed Grave

    Many learned about Johnny Appleseed in grade school, who we remember as the man who introduced apple trees to much of the Midwest. He became an American legend in our memories for his pioneering eccentric story and efforts in conservation.
